2013 Honda VT1300CXA Fury, New 2013 Honda VT1300 Fury - It looks like a piece of custom motorcycle art, but there’s so much more to the Honda VT1300CXA Fury than its radical appearance. This is a bike that you’ll want to ride, not just admire. Unlike some other wild customs, the Fury steers and rides with a predictability that makes you immediately feel comfortable and in control. A specially designed shaft-drive system cleanly and quietly transfers power from the big 1,312 cc V-twin engine to the huge 200-series rear tire, adding to the Fury’s uncluttered look while also keeping maintenance to a minimum. And if you need to stop in a hurry, Honda’s Combined Braking System with ABS provides both the operating ease of linked brakes and the control of an advanced anti-lock braking system. Honda Tuner Mugen Motorsports to Enter 2012 TT Zero Electric Race at Isle of Man

Thu, 16 Feb 2012

Engine tuning company Mugen Motorsports announced it will compete in the TT Zero electric motorcycle race at the 2012 Isle of Man TT. Though not officially a Honda company,Mugen was founded by Hirotoshi Honda, son of Honda founder Soichiro Honda, and the company is best known for its work as an engine tuner and parts maker for Honda vehicles. The Mugen entry to the TT Zero represents possibly the closest connection so far between a traditional motorcycle OEM and the relatively new realm of electric motorcycle racing.

2013 Mugen Shinden Ni Electric Race Bike Revealed

Fri, 10 May 2013

Noted Honda tuning company Mugen has revealed the second generation version of its electric racebike which will race in the TT Zero at the 2013 Isle of Man TT. The Shinden Ni (“Shinden” meaning “God of Electricity” while “Ni” is the number two in Japanese) will once again be ridden by 19-time TT winner John McGuinness. Mugen has been working on the Shinden Ni since last year’s TT Zero, using data collected in the race and during tests at circuits in Japan.
